Monday, January 10, 2005

New iPod to have FM radio built-in?

Lindsay Lohan has spoken on TV ("Access Hollywood") about filming an advert for the "Apple iPod Radio". More info below.
Mac OS Rumors :: The Original Mac Rumor Site.